Abstract
The utility model discloses a kind of polyamide composite filaments production up- coiler, frame is provided with rotating disk and floating roller seat, and the bobbin driven by power set is provided with rotating disk, and floating roller seat is rotatablely equipped with friction roller;Floating roller seat is additionally provided with magnet coil, and magnet coil is corresponding with the friction roller position, and friction roller includes friction roller body, and friction roller body interior is provided with electric conductor.The utility model have it is simple in construction, using, it is easy for installation, operating efficiency is high, and solve friction roller loses fast problem, and energy consumption is low, and floor space is few, and cost is low, applied widely, it is possible to increase the characteristics of product quality.

In order to solve the above technical problems, the technical solution of the utility model is:
A kind of polyamide composite filaments production up- coiler, including frame, the frame is provided with rotating disk and floating roller seat, described
The bobbin driven by power set is installed, the floating roller seat is rotatablely equipped with friction roller on rotating disk;The floating roller seat is also
Magnet coil is provided with, forms motor stator, the magnet coil is corresponding with the friction roller position, and the friction roller includes
Rub roller body, and the friction roller body interior is provided with electric conductor, forms rotor, motor stator and rotor are formed
Motor.
Preferably, described friction roller body is embedded is provided with some electric conductors, is built in friction roller body.
Preferably, described friction roller body is embedded is provided with a circle electric conductor, forms conductive layer, is built in friction roller body
It is interior.
Preferably, it is provided with distance between described friction roller and motor stator.
Preferably, can be adjusted apart from size between described friction roller and motor stator.
Preferably, speed probe is additionally provided with described friction roller, the magnet coil is also associated with frequency converter, institute
State speed probe and frequency converter is connected to programmable controller., will according to product by control of the controller to magnet coil
Friction roller can be driven continuously or by the defined time by asking.The separation of friction roller and motor stator in structure causes stator
More flexibly friction roller can be driven, and can also moved, so as to adjust distance between the two;Can also be
When carrying out tow spinning-in operation, the driving to friction roller is interrupted, the maintenance work to up- coiler provides facility.

Embodiment
With reference to the accompanying drawings and examples, the utility model is expanded on further.
As shown in Figure 1 to Figure 3, a kind of polyamide composite filaments production up- coiler provided by the utility model, including filar guide
6th, bobbin 9 and rotating disk 10;Also include the friction roller body 1 being arranged on the floating roller seat of up- coiler, set in friction roller body 1
There is a circle electric conductor 2 (formation rotor);Connector 3 is additionally provided with friction roller body 1, friction roller 4 is connected by connector 3
Chuck is connected to, friction roller 4 is also associated with speed probe;The floating roller seat of up- coiler is additionally provided with what is formed with magnet coil 5
Motor stator, motor stator and friction roller 4 (rotor) relative set, form electric machine structure.
During practical application, under the silk pressing effect of friction roller 4, spinning cake is wound on bobbin 9 by filar guide 6 for tow 7
8, in the process, controller is controlled to the rotating speed of friction roller 4.Motor frequency conversion control, speed are arbitrarily set in whole production
It is fixed;Weight of package and time need artificial setting, and achievable automatically switch falls silk.
Because being transformed the friction roller 4 of up- coiler, electric conductor 2 is added, and accordingly increased the shape of magnet coil 5
Into electric machine structure, the rotating speed of friction roller 4 is stabilized, reduces relevant device, serve the effect of energy-saving upgrading synergy.
